Cost of Tile Drain Replacement in Burleson
The cost of tile drain replacement in Burleson, TX can vary significantly based on several factors. Whether you're dealing with an aging system or unexpected damage, understanding the various elements that influence the overall expense can help you plan and budget effectively.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Type of Tile Drain: The material and design of the tile drain can significantly impact the cost.
- Length of Drainage System: Longer systems require more materials and labor, increasing the total cost.
- Depth of Installation: Deeper installations are more labor-intensive and often more expensive.
- Soil Conditions: Rocky or clay-heavy soils can complicate installation and raise costs.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all expense.
- Labor Costs: The cost of labor can vary depending on the contractor and the complexity of the job.
- Disposal Fees: Removing and disposing of old materials can add to the cost.
Average Costs for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ost (USD) |
---|---|
Tile Drain Replacement (per foot) | $30 - $50 |
Excavation and Removal | $500 - $1,000 |
New Tile Drain Installation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Permits and Inspections | $100 - $300 |
Soil Testing | $200 - $400 |
Labor (per hour) | $50 - $100 |
Disposal Fees | $100 - $300 |
